Output ae8acfc45c56ab8e52526aa181b0468fa32bd6483534c7fa49f2fa3525f38235:0

value
19819684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 539e6042a6f5016b1409838286edf1527fc7fb7e37fb412121079dfca4841270
address
tb1p2w0xqs4x75qkk9qfswpgdm032flu07m7xla5zgfpq7wlefyyzfcq9tu5lg
transaction
ae8acfc45c56ab8e52526aa181b0468fa32bd6483534c7fa49f2fa3525f38235
confirmations
42900
spent
true